Diagnostic Aids
DTC is usually set by contamination. Contamination can be caused by fuel, improper use of RTV, engine oil or coolant. Repair cause of contamination first before replacing oxygen sensor.
An intermittent condition may be caused by poor connection, rubbed-through insulation, or a broken wire inside insulation. Check PCM harness connectors for backed-out terminals, improper mating, broken locks, improperly formed or damaged terminals, or poor terminal-to-wire connections before component replacement.
